Witnesses reportedly observed a man pulling over near FM 1409 and Perry Avenue, where he allegedly opened his trunk and left two dogs on the road before driving away. The man, identified as 41-year-old Fernando Cantù, was arrested and charged with four counts of animal cruelty. The abandoned dogs were rescued by Mont Belvieu Animal Services and are currently in the shelter awaiting potential adoption.
